25/03/1950 Stratford Works One of the two 0-4-0T tram engines-No. 68083- has just been through shops. The crest is on the undercarriage, below the wooden body. One of the 0-6-0T tram engines has the words 'British Railways' in the same position, and does not look as neat. Locomotives in the new shops were Nos. 61004/42/50/54/89, 61332/35. 1639. 62531, 3040. 63101, 7160, 68527, 69704, 90013, 90502. ex-W.D. 77013, 79312 and outside awaiting shopping were Nos. 61235, 61559, 8386, 8647, 9684, 90392. The three Crane locomotives are now renumbered; No. 68667 noted 3/49, No. 68668 2/50 and No. 68669 3/50 (with crest). These dates are not given in the official lists, and the actual dates will be slightly earlier. In the Paint Shop were Nos. 61540 (lined), 61554. 68088, 68225, 68651, 69641, 69728; and in the old Works Nos. 61058, 61336, 61558, 62509, 2584, 2601. 62790, 2794, 4644/83, 65462, 65545/57, 7155, 7226, 8375, 8519/61, 8772, 8874/81, 9639/69. 21/11/1960 G.E. Dieselisation Extensive dieselisation has taken place on the GE and a considerable re-shuffle of diesels between March, Ipswich and Stratford took place on 21st November. Cambridge has lost all its passenger turns (steam) and its entire allocation of Bls (61046/8/66/71/82, 61236/52/3/4/80/3) has been transferred to March and Norwich, leaving 16 steam engines allocated. South Lynn is now a sub-shed of March, its allocation being 43089/90, 65548/77 an 68499. Lowestoft has lost its 3 steam engines (65462, 65588 and 68642) to store at Trowse and is completely diesel, i.e. D2039, D2553/5/68/70/3. SLS/196101
